
The Data Revolution: How AI is Transforming Information Extraction
Imagine standing at the intersection of technological innovation, where artificial intelligence meets data extraction. This is precisely where web scraping and ChatGPT converge, creating a transformative landscape that‘s reshaping how professionals gather, analyze, and leverage digital information.
Web scraping has long been the domain of technical experts—programmers who could navigate complex coding environments and build sophisticated extraction scripts. Traditional approaches required deep programming knowledge, intricate understanding of HTML structures, and significant time investment. But everything changed with the emergence of ChatGPT.
Understanding the Web Scraping Ecosystem
The digital landscape is increasingly data-driven, with organizations and researchers constantly seeking efficient methods to extract meaningful insights from online sources. Web scraping represents a critical technique in this information acquisition process, enabling rapid, automated collection of web-based data across diverse platforms.
The Evolution of Data Extraction Technologies
Historically, web scraping emerged as a niche technical skill, requiring specialized programming knowledge. Early practitioners used basic scripting languages like Python and Perl to build custom extraction mechanisms. These initial approaches were complex, brittle, and demanded significant technical expertise.
As web technologies became more sophisticated, so did scraping methodologies. The introduction of libraries like BeautifulSoup and Scrapy revolutionized the field, providing more robust and flexible extraction frameworks. These tools abstracted many technical complexities, making web scraping more accessible to developers and researchers.
ChatGPT: A Paradigm Shift in Web Scraping
ChatGPT represents a quantum leap in artificial intelligence‘s capabilities, particularly in the realm of web scraping and data extraction. While it cannot directly scrape websites, its ability to generate code, provide technical guidance, and solve complex programming challenges is unprecedented.
Technical Capabilities and Limitations
Unlike traditional scraping tools, ChatGPT offers a conversational approach to data extraction challenges. It can:
- Generate extraction scripts in multiple programming languages
- Explain complex web scraping concepts
- Provide troubleshooting guidance
- Offer strategic implementation advice
However, it‘s crucial to understand ChatGPT‘s limitations. The model cannot:
- Directly browse websites
- Execute real-time data extraction
- Maintain persistent web sessions
- Handle highly dynamic web content
Practical Implementation Strategies
Integrating ChatGPT with Web Scraping Workflows
Successful web scraping with ChatGPT requires a strategic approach. Here‘s a comprehensive methodology for leveraging AI in your data extraction projects:
- Code Generation and Optimization
ChatGPT excels at generating foundational scraping scripts. By providing clear, specific prompts, you can obtain high-quality code snippets tailored to your extraction requirements.
Example Python Scraping Script:
\[import requests\]
\[from bs4 import BeautifulSoup\]
def extract_website_data(url):
response = requests.get(url)
soup = BeautifulSoup(response.text, ‘html.parser‘)
# Advanced extraction logic
Error Handling and Debugging
One of ChatGPT‘s most powerful features is its ability to diagnose and resolve coding challenges. By presenting specific error messages, you can receive targeted troubleshooting advice.Regular Expression and XPath Assistance
Complex data extraction often requires sophisticated pattern matching. ChatGPT can generate and explain regular expressions and XPath selectors, dramatically reducing development time.
Market Trends and Technological Landscape
Web Scraping Tools Ecosystem
The web scraping market is experiencing rapid transformation. Emerging tools are integrating machine learning, distributed computing, and AI-powered optimization techniques.
Key players in the market include:
- Octoparse: No-code extraction platform
- ParseHub: Machine learning-enhanced scraping
- Beautiful Soup: Lightweight Python library
- Scrapy: High-performance open-source framework
Market Size and Growth Projections
Industry analysts predict the global web scraping market will reach approximately [USD 4.5 billion] by 2027, with a compound annual growth rate exceeding 30%. This explosive growth reflects increasing demand across industries like:
- Market research
- Competitive intelligence
- Academic research
- Business intelligence
- Digital marketing
Ethical Considerations and Best Practices
Navigating Legal and Ethical Challenges
Web scraping exists in a complex legal and ethical landscape. Responsible practitioners must:
- Respect website terms of service
- Implement robust rate limiting
- Use proper user-agent identification
- Obtain necessary permissions
- Protect individual privacy
Data Privacy and Compliance
With regulations like GDPR and CCPA, data extraction requires meticulous attention to privacy standards. This means:
- Anonymizing collected data
- Implementing secure storage mechanisms
- Transparent data collection practices
- Obtaining explicit consent when required
Future of AI-Powered Data Extraction
Emerging Technologies and Trends
The convergence of AI, machine learning, and web scraping promises exciting developments:
- Distributed scraping networks
- Intelligent data cleaning algorithms
- Predictive extraction methodologies
- Enhanced privacy protection techniques
Conclusion: Navigating the Future of Information Extraction
Web scraping stands at a fascinating technological crossroads. ChatGPT and similar AI technologies are not replacing specialized tools but dramatically enhancing human capabilities in data extraction.
The future belongs to professionals who can strategically combine technological expertise, ethical considerations, and innovative approaches to information gathering.
Key Recommendations
- Continuously update technical skills
- Embrace AI as a collaborative tool
- Prioritize ethical data collection
- Stay informed about technological advancements
By adopting a holistic, forward-thinking approach, you‘ll be well-positioned to leverage the transformative potential of AI-powered web scraping.